Saw palmetto, derived from the berries of the Serenoa repens plant, contains a complex array of active compounds, including fatty acids and sterols, which are believed to influence testosterone metabolism and inhibit the enzyme responsible for its conversion. By potentially inhibiting 5-alpha-reductase, the enzyme that converts testosterone to DHT, saw palmetto may help maintain healthier prostate tissue.
